Man dies after hit-and-run in Mississauga; driver still not caught

Summary by Insauga
A man has died after a hit-and-run in Mississauga earlier this month and the driver has still not been caught, police say. Peel Regional Police responded to the scene on Dundas Street West between Erindale Station and Old Carriage roads at 11:40 p.m. on Sept. 6 after a 27-year-old pedestrian from Mississauga was hit by a car.
